I usually hang out in the Super Duty and V10 Forums, but I thought I would wander over here after our recent purchase. My wife found us this 1977 19' Layton a few weeks ago. It isn't that pretty, but it's in great condition, clean inside, newer tires, and everything works.
We were getting tired of tent camping with two little girls, so decided to start looking for an old 1970's or early 80's camper since they are cheap, but well built. We plan on fixing it up and keeping it for a few years and then upgrading to something bigger (25'+). We didn't want to finance our fun though , so this was perfect since it was ready to use, and the 350 hardly knows it's back there. A big advantage when doing a lot of camping in the Sierra Nevada's. Now I just need to do an axle flip so I can actually get into some of our dry camping locations without inadvertently removing the waste water plumbing.
This is from our first camping trip on the weekend before Veteran's Day at Diaz Lake outside of Lonepine CA. Beautiful weather and not too far from home.
